Transaction 56a3fa68dec8a6075e03021f94598613c1462dea983f90165194d2ad613e4d80

1 Input
2 Outputs
  • 56a3fa68dec8a6075e03021f94598613c1462dea983f90165194d2ad613e4d80:0
  • value  8735239
    address  1E9yPLpGY4RGTh12MxR3gVHvatZMXJSwFL
  • 56a3fa68dec8a6075e03021f94598613c1462dea983f90165194d2ad613e4d80:1
  • value  322538
    address  1KaPuwSMDrUVTEvRikyPkMoHGWnhtpjgii